|
Match
|
Document |
Document Title |
|
|
6208955 |
Distributed maintenance system based on causal networks
The present invention relates to a diagnostic system for complex systems such as avionics systems. The diagnostic system acquires a description of the system from a variety of design tools and...
|
|
|
6205223 |
Input data format autodetection systems and methods
A method of automatically detecting a data format type of a stream of data. A determination is made as to whether a current word and a previously received words comprise a set of identifiers...
|
|
|
6199117 |
Generalized control for starting of tasks (processes and threads)
A generalized applications programming interface (API) is inserted as a separate level above the API's of the operating system in a data processing system and used to invoke a group of operating...
|
|
|
6173249 |
Method of determining termination of a process under a simulated operating system
An operating system is simulated to run in conjunction with a native operating system, allowing processes originally developed for the operating system being simulated to be ported to the...
|
|
|
6163761 |
System for monitoring and controlling production and method therefor
An electronic production system and method are capable of handling dynamic process production data. The electronic production system includes a memory; an input/output interface for receiving...
|
|
|
6157940 |
Automated client-based web server stress tool simulating simultaneous multiple user server accesses
A computerized subsystem starts multiple user-defined threads, each of which is a virtual browser for a web site server application under test and executing on a web server. Each individual virtual...
|
|
|
6148278 |
Emulating the S/390 read backwards tape operation on SCSI attached tape devices
Disclosed is a method for attaching SCSI tape devices which may only read in a forward direction to an S/390 compatible computer system. This involves translating S/390 I/O operations for channel...
|
|
|
6148279 |
Apparatus for recording and/or reading program history
An integrated circuit, apparatus and method is provided for programming manufacturing information and software program information upon non-volatile storage elements on the integrated circuit. The...
|
|
|
6142682 |
Simulation of computer processor
An instruction emulation system translates target instructions into emulation instructions for execution by a host processor. A jump table has pointer entries employed to locate, in a translation...
|
|
|
6141633 |
Logical device verification method and apparatus
A verification apparatus which verifies whether or not a finite state machine indicating the operation of a synchronous sequential machine satisfies the property indicating the functional...
|
|
|
6134606 |
System/method for controlling parameters in hand-held digital camera with selectable parameter scripts, and with command for retrieving camera capabilities and associated permissible parameter values
A system and method for controlling parameters in an electronic imaging device comprises a series of parameter storage locations coupled to the imaging device for containing parameter value sets, a...
|
|
|
6134516 |
Simulation server system and method
The SEmulation system provides four modes of operation: (1) Software Simulation, (2) Simulation via Hardware Acceleration, (3) In-Circuit Emulation (ICE), and (4) Post-Simulation Analysis. At a...
|
|
|
6128698 |
Tape drive emulator for removable disk drive
A tape drive emulator (30) is between a host computer (40) and a removable disk drive (22) and appears to the host computer 40 as a sequential storage system, e.g., a tape drive. However, the tape...
|
|
|
6128590 |
Method for the migration of hardware-proximate, subprogram-independent programs with portable and non-portable program parts
The method is for moving hardware-proximate and subprogram-independent program code. Portable program parts (C, D) for the destination hardware are respectively recompiled and all entry points at...
|
|
|
6113645 |
Simulated play of interactive multimedia applications for error detection
An interactive multimedia application executes in a debug mode in which a tester can specify a particular classification of user event and a user event satisfying the particular classification is...
|
|
|
6112023 |
Scheduling-based hardware-software co-synthesis of heterogeneous distributed embedded systems
Hardware-software co-synthesis is the process of partitioning an embedded system specification into hardware and software modules to meet performance, power, and cost goals. Embedded systems are...
|
|
|
6106566 |
Upgradable electronic module and system using same
An upgradable Pentium-based mobile processor module that is forward-compatible with an enhanced Pentium II-based mobile processor module. The upgradable Pentium-based mobile processor module uses...
|
|
|
6104870 |
Method and system for improving communications in data communications networks that provide network emulation
A method and system for improving communications in data communications networks which provide network emulation. The method and system accomplish their objects via communications equipment adapted...
|
|
|
6094691 |
Method for the identification of an integrated circuit and associated device
A method is for the identification of an integrated circuit, and includes steps for writing, in a volatile register, a required number; the decoding, in the integrated circuit, of the required...
|
|
|
6092139 |
Passive backplane capable of being configured to a variable data path width corresponding to a data size of the pluggable CPU board
A computer system includes a bus system having a local bus unit, a memory bus unit, an input/output bus unit, and an expansion bus unit. A pluggable central processing unit circuit board includes a...
|
|
|
6086624 |
Simulator and simulation method in each of which simulation can be carried out at a high-speed
In a simulator for simulating, on a host computer having a host central processing unit, a target program (100) which is prepared for execution on a target computer and has a typical process part...
|
|
|
6086623 |
Method and implementation for intercepting and processing system calls in programmed digital computer to emulate retrograde operating system
A current operating system such as SolarisĀ® X86 is adapted to run a user program such as a Common Object File Format (COFF) executable program which was designed to run on a retrograde operating...
|
|
|
6086622 |
Method and apparatus for converting an architecture of a program and method, and apparatus for debugging a program by using them
A first high-level language source program for a computer of a first architecture is compiled, thereby producing a machine program for a computer of a second architecture. The machine program is...
|
|
|
6083270 |
Devices and methods for interfacing human users with electronic devices
A method of interfacing human users with electronic devices liberates electronic devices from specific input and output devices and substitutes a universal communication system between them. The...
|
|
|
6081836 |
Method for the transmission of information packets between emulated LANs using address resolution
Method for the transmission of information packets between a source LEC of a first ELAN and a destination LEC of a second ELAN, having the following method steps: determination of the destination...
|
|
|
6081890 |
Method of communication between firmware written for different instruction set architectures
A firmware system comprises a legacy firmware module and a native firmware module written for native and legacy instruction set architectures (ISAs), respectively. A data structure is associated...
|
|
|
6080202 |
Universal compatibility software system for services in communication and information processing networks
A method to control feature interaction and ensure compatibility among disparate service features, resources and terminals of a communications network is provided. Resource devices and terminals...
|
|
|
6074432 |
Method for generating a software class compatible with two or more interpreters
The invention provides a technique for generating a portable software class that includes native methods, i.e., a software class compatible with interpreters conforming to two or more different...
|
|
|
6075938 |
Virtual machine monitors for scalable multiprocessors
The problem of extending modern operating systems to run efficiently on large-scale shared memory multiprocessors without a large implementation effort is solved by a unique type of virtual machine...
|
|
|
6068661 |
Method of emulating synchronous communication
The invention configures an asynchronous system to emulate a synchronous system. When an application initiates a synchronous transaction, the synchronous transaction is received by a synchronous...
|
|
|
6059837 |
Method and system for automata-based approach to state reachability of interacting extended finite state machines
A method and system for an automata-based approach to state reachability of an interacting extended finite state machine. The present invention comprises a computer system having a processor, and a...
|
|
|
6051030 |
Emulation module having planar array organization
Emulation modules containing an increased number of emulation processors are logically reconfigured into a plurality of planes which are interconnected by means of multiplexors to avoid I/O pinout...
|
|
|
6052749 |
System for forming an intelligent I/O (I.sub.2 O)-aware device by connecting both a peripheral control connector having an I/O processor mounted and non-I.sub.2 O device to same bus
Apparatus, and an associated method, converts a conventional computer peripheral device, such as an I/O (input/output) subsystem into an I 2 O-aware device. An IOP mounted upon a connector card is...
|
|
|
6049668 |
Method and apparatus for supporting multiple processor-specific code segments in a single executable
A computer-implemented method identifies a code segment which is to be customized to a plurality of different processor types. The method generates object code for the code segment, including...
|
|
|
6047120 |
Dual mode bus bridge for interfacing a host bus and a personal computer interface bus
The dual mode bus bridge accommodates either two 64-bit personal computer interface (PCI) buses or four 32-bit PCI buses. In either case, only a single load is applied to the host bus. The dual...
|
|
|
6041176 |
Emulation devices utilizing state machines
An emulation device which enables a functional circuit to support self emulation. A serial scan testability interface has at least first, second and third scan paths, said first scan path being...
|
|
|
6039765 |
Computer instruction which generates multiple results of different data types to improve software emulation
Accelerating software emulation and other data processing operations utilizes execution of a single computer instruction that produces multiple data type results from a single source. The...
|
|
|
6038392 |
Implementation of boolean satisfiability with non-chronological backtracking in reconfigurable hardware
A Boolean SAT solver uses reconfigurable hardware to solve a specific input problem. Each of the plurality of ordered variables has a corresponding one of a plurality of state machines. Each state...
|
|
|
6035116 |
Information processing apparatus having an initializing emulation program to provide compatibility between different models
An information processing system and apparatus and an information recording medium wherein the compatibility of a program between preceding and succeeding models is assured without requiring a high...
|
|
|
6018763 |
High performance shared memory for a bridge router supporting cache coherency
An internetwork device manages the flow of packets of I/O data among a plurality of network interface devices. The internetwork device includes an I/O bus which is coupled to the plurality of...
|
|
|
6014512 |
Method and apparatus for simulation of a multi-processor circuit
Multiple processor circuit simulator comprising a debugger interface, a synchronizer, a RISC processor simulator, a vector processor simulator, a shared memory, a co-processor interface module and...
|
|
|
6014714 |
Adapter card system including for supporting multiple configurations using mapping bit
An adapter card which includes a non volatile memory for containing configuration parameters for establishing one of a plurality of configurations for the adapter card, as well as a pair of mapping...
|
|
|
6012104 |
Method and apparatus for dynamic extension of channel programs
The present invention provides a method, system, and computer program product for extending channel programs in a computer system which uses a channel sub-system. An initial channel program is...
|
|
|
6009262 |
Parallel computer system and method of communication between the processors of the parallel computer system
A parallel computer system which divides the entire space of facilities into a plurality of small divisions; assigns a plurality of processors thereof to the divisions, respectively, the lower...
|
|
|
6009263 |
Emulating agent and method for reformatting computer instructions into a standard uniform format
An emulating agent and method is provided that receives numbers having si, exponents and significands of varying lengths and possibly configured in a variety of incompatible formats and to reformat...
|
|
|
6009261 |
Preprocessing of stored target routines for emulating incompatible instructions on a target processor
Provides a program translation and execution method which stores target routines (for execution by a target processor) corresponding to incompatible instructions, interruptions and authorizations...
|
|
|
6009264 |
Node coordination using a channel object and point-to-point protocol
A method, apparatus, and article of manufacture for coordinating a plurality of sub-tasks performed by a group of nodes of a parallel processor computer system. An application subdivides a function...
|
|
|
6006295 |
Translator with selectable FIFO for universal hub cables for connecting a PC's PCMCIA or parallel ports to various peripherals using IDE/ATAPI, SCSI, or general I/O
A universal cable connects a personal computer's parallel port or PCMCIA socket to a variety of types of external peripheral devices. The universal cable contains a translator circuit that converts...
|
|
|
6006277 |
Virtual software machine for enabling CICS application software to run on UNIX based computer systems
The present invention relates to a virtual software machine for providing a virtual execution environment in a target computer for an application software program having one or more execution...
|
|
|
6002864 |
Host addresses a client device using permanent name provided by the client device without requiring a transfer of an APPC verb
A method of enabling communication between a terminal emulator client device and a host computer through an intermediary server computer. The terminal emulator client device is preferably a...
|